WILD Nebraska is a program partnership between the Lower Platte South Natural Resources District (LPSNRD) and the Nebraska Game and Parks Commission (NG&PC) to improve wildlife habitat. The program enables cooperators to re-establish and enhance wildlife habitats on private lands through cost-sharing incentives. The WILD Nebraska Program is divided into grasslands, wetlands, woodlands, and general activities.

Procedure to participate in this program include:

  1. Cooperator obtains program and activities information from LPSNRD or the Nebraska Game & Parks Commission
  2. Cooperator submits an application form to the LPSNRD.
  3. Representatives from the LPSNRD and NG&PC visit the site with the cooperator and prepare a management or development plan for the wildlife habitat activities.
  4. Cooperator contract is prepared, reviewed and signed.
  5. Cooperator then installs the habitat activities as stated in the plan.
  6. Contract site is inspected after each activity is performed and is paid upon project completion. Transition payments will be paid at the end of each performance year after a successful compliance inspection.
